Summary
Voluntary Support for Reservists and National Guard Members Act - Amends the Internal Revenue Code to allow taxpayers to designate that a portion (but not less than $5) of any income tax overpayment be paid over to the Reserve Income Replacement Program to benefit reservists and National Guard members.
